Trumpet is a wonderful 1950’s elephant with fantastic markings. Sadly for his 60 old plus years he does have some failings. He has wear on his back which you can see in the pictures. He has colour fading where his ceremonial cover has been  (the cover is dusty). He has a stain on his right hand side. His ceremonial cover does cover most of this. He is grubby. However, good old trumpet has some great things going for him as well. Firstly he still retains his pull cord, when pulled it makes what I can only describe as a “mooing” noise, but it is clear. His marking are wonderful. The markings around his eyes and his eyes look almost real. (Please look at the pictures and you will see what I mean). Trumpet must have some form of rod going through his head, because if you move one ear the ear on the other side will move as well. (Please note when touching the right ear, a piece of wire sometimes pokes through but this will push back in. It is something that just a stitch will cure but not a problem)

 

I have had Trumpet for many years and he is fresh on the market. I am sad to see Trumpet go and I am hoping that he will find his forever home. In due elephant spirit, Trumpet is really heavy and is 21″ in length and approx 16″ high.

 

 

I am not sure who made him but have discussed him with two dealers over a period of time and it is felt he is possibly of German origin, could well be Hermann.
